Carers Week (June 5-11) - is an annual campaign to raise awareness of caring, highlight the challenges unpaid carers face and recognise the contribution they make to families and communities throughout the UK. 

 

A number of organisations, including Carers Support Merton and Merton Mencap, are working with the council to put on a week of events recognising carers.

Routine HIV testing to be offered in Trust’s mental health assessment suite

 
All patients aged 18 years and over will now be routinely tested for HIV when they attend the Lotus Assessment Suite at Springfield Hospital.
